Pinot Grigio: how to pair it?

Pinot Gris is a grape variety that originates in Alsace, where – thanks to the favorable climatic conditions – it still represents the most cultivated grape for the number of hectares of vines. Chianti Riserva: the characteristics of one of the most loved Italian Wine

Chianti Riserva is one of the types of wine included in the Chianti DOCG denomination: one of the most loved, known, and sold Italian wines. Leonardo da Vinci and the journey to Romagna: discover the wine Mappa di Imola.

 In 1502 Leonardo da Vinci was commissioned by Cesare Borgia to review and improve the infrastructures and fortifications in the territory of the Duchy of Romagna.
